Understanding Specialized Cleaning's Importance
In medical settings, specialized sanitization is not just advantageous - it's a necessity. These are environments where patient safety and infection control are paramount. Each surface, instrument, and device must follow stringent cleaning requirements to prevent the spread of pathogens and protect both patients and healthcare workers.
When you examine the array of contaminants found in a medical office—from bodily fluids and blood to harmful microorganisms—the need for precise cleaning becomes evident. It goes beyond routine cleaning; it's about using hospital-grade disinfectants and implementing detailed cleaning protocols that effectively eliminate dangerous pathogens.
What's more, expert cleaning extends beyond what meets the eye. It comprises consistent disinfection of commonly touched points namely doorknobs, light switches, and medical equipment that frequently go unnoticed but remain vital in preventing cross-contamination.
Regular maintenance must include HVAC ducts and ventilation components, that might trap and spread unwanted particles if regular maintenance is overlooked.
Your part in preserving these standards is crucial. By guaranteeing that all cleaning work is performed correctly, you help create a safer environment for all who enter the doors of the medical office.
Compliance with Standards and Regulations
Adhering to established standards and regulations is vital for medical office cleaning in website Chicago. You must ensure your cleaning practices meet the stringent requirements set by agencies like OSHA and the CDC, prioritizing infection control and patient safety. This goes beyond about ensuring spotless areas; it's about employing techniques that substantially minimize the likelihood of infection transmission.
You must comply with various regulations that dictate the proper handling and disposal of biomedical waste, appropriate usage of disinfectants, and how often to clean distinct zones of your facility. Adhering to these standards isn't just recommended; it's a regulatory necessity that ensures the safety of both patients and staff from health-related dangers.
Additionally, every area throughout your healthcare facility, from patient waiting areas to surgical facilities, requires distinct cleaning procedures. These procedures are established to manage the unique requirements present in each area.
High-touch surfaces like doorknobs, chairs, and counters require more frequent and thorough cleaning compared to other areas. It's your responsibility to ensure these procedures are carefully implemented to preserve a secure environment.
